About The Job
Be part of a team that pushes boundaries, developing custom silicon solutions that power the future of Google's direct-to-consumer products. You'll contribute to the innovation behind products loved by millions worldwide. Your expertise will shape the next generation of hardware experiences, delivering unparalleled performance, efficiency, and integration.
As a Performance, Power and Thermal Architect, you will help drive Mobile SoC Architecture optimized for Performance, Power and Thermal. This role will analyze mobile workloads, identify performance bottlenecks and power optimization opportunities in hardware/software architecture, and work with cross-functional teams to implement these solutions.

Responsibilities
Conduct performance, power, thermal analysis in both qualitative and quantitative fashion effectively.
Identify performance bottlenecks across workloads on Mobile SoCs and suggest potential optimizations to improve Performance/Power.
Identify software and hardware architectural optimizations for mobile/tablet workloads (ML/Gen-AI, Browsing, Camera, etc).
Evaluate architectural options, trade-offs (CPU Cache sizing, Core configuration, Memory controller QoS, etc) and develop architecture proposals /justification.
Perform Deep-dive analyses for CPU, GPU, ML/Gen-AI and Memory bound workloads.
